git.dev分支
-
Git的dev分支是指在Git版本控制系统中的一个分支,用于开发新功能或进行实验性工作。通常情况下,一个项目会有多个分支,其中dev分支是主要的开发分支之一。
dev分支通常被用于新功能的开发,这样可以保持主分支的稳定性。开发人员可以在dev分支上进行各种实验性的功能开发和改进,而不会影响到主分支的稳定性。一旦新功能完善并经过测试,开发人员可以将其合并到主分支上。
在使用Git进行开发时,可以使用以下命令创建和操作dev分支:
1. 创建dev分支: 使用命令`git branch dev`可以创建一个名为dev的新分支。
2. 切换到dev分支: 使用命令`git checkout dev`可以切换到dev分支。
3. 在dev分支上进行开发: 在dev分支上进行代码修改和功能开发,可以使用常规的Git命令进行版本控制,例如`git add`、`git commit`等。
4. 合并dev分支到主分支: 在dev分支上的开发完成后,可以使用命令`git checkout main`切换回主分支,然后使用命令`git merge dev`将dev分支的代码合并到主分支上,这样新功能就被添加到了主分支上。
通过使用dev分支,开发人员可以更加灵活地进行代码开发和管理,保证主分支的稳定性,同时在dev分支上进行实验和新功能的开发。这种分支的使用方式可以帮助团队更好地协作和进行并行开发,提高开发效率和代码质量。
1年前 -
git.dev分支是指Git版本控制系统中的一个分支,可以用于开发团队协作开发的目的。下面是关于git.dev分支的5个要点:
1. 创建git.dev分支:可以使用如下命令在本地和远程创建一个名为git.dev的分支:
“`
git branch git.dev
git push origin git.dev
“`
这将在本地和远程创建一个新的git.dev分支。2. 切换到git.dev分支:可以使用如下命令切换到git.dev分支:
“`
git checkout git.dev
“`
这将把当前工作目录切换到git.dev分支。3. 在git.dev分支上进行开发:一旦切换到git.dev分支,你可以在这个分支上自由地进行开发工作。你可以添加、修改和删除文件,进行代码的编写和测试等。
4. 合并到主分支:当你在git.dev分支上完成了开发工作并且测试通过后,你可以将git.dev分支的更改合并到主分支(通常是master分支)中。你可以使用如下命令进行合并:
“`
git checkout master
git merge git.dev
“`
这将把git.dev分支上的更改合并到master分支中。5. 解决冲突:在合并分支时,有时候可能会遇到冲突。这发生在Git无法自动合并两个分支的更改时。当发生冲突时,你需要手动解决冲突,并将解决后的代码提交到版本控制系统中。
总结起来,git.dev分支是一种用于团队开发协作的分支,可以用来独立开发和测试新功能,最后将更改合并到主分支中。使用git.dev分支可以有效地管理开发过程,并确保团队成员之间的工作不会相互干扰。
1年前 -
git.dev分支是一个在Git中常见的分支,通常用于开发团队协作开发项目的一个特定功能或特性。
为了更好地理解git.dev分支的概念,下面将会从以下几个方面进行讲解:
1. 创建git.dev分支
2. 切换到git.dev分支
3. 在git.dev分支上进行开发
4. 将git.dev分支合并到主分支(如master分支)
5. 删除git.dev分支
6. 解决冲突### 1. 创建git.dev分支
要创建git.dev分支,可以使用以下命令:
“`
git branch git.dev
“`
这将在当前仓库中创建一个名为git.dev的分支。注意,在创建分支时,它将复制当前所在分支的内容。### 2. 切换到git.dev分支
要切换到git.dev分支,使用以下命令:
“`
git checkout git.dev
“`
这将让你进入到git.dev分支,并且你将在该分支上进行操作。### 3. 在git.dev分支上进行开发
现在,你可以在git.dev分支上进行你的开发工作了。你可以新增、修改或删除代码文件,进行各种操作。### 4. 将git.dev分支合并到主分支
当在git.dev分支上的开发完成后,你可能希望将git.dev分支的内容合并到主要分支(如master分支)。以下是合并的步骤:
“`
git checkout master // 切换到主分支
git merge git.dev // 将git.dev分支合并到主分支
“`
这将把git.dev分支的更改合并到主分支。如果在合并过程中发生冲突,需要解决冲突(将在后面的部分讨论)。### 5. 删除git.dev分支
如果你完成了对git.dev分支的操作,并且不再需要该分支,可以使用以下命令删除该分支:
“`
git branch -d git.dev
“`
这将从仓库中删除git.dev分支。请注意,如果该分支还有未合并的更改,删除分支可能会失败。如果要强制删除分支,可以使用`-D`参数。### 6. 解决冲突
在将git.dev分支合并到主分支时,可能会遇到冲突。冲突是指在合并的过程中,同一文件的相同行被不同的修改覆盖了。为了解决冲突,可以按照以下步骤进行:
1. 打开冲突的文件,并查看冲突的位置。冲突的位置将会有类似于以下的标记:
“`
<<<<<<< HEAD// 你当前所在分支的修改=======// git.dev分支的修改>>>>>>> git.dev
“`
`<<<<<<< HEAD`到`=======`之间是当前分支的修改,`=======`到`>>>>>>> git.dev`之间是git.dev分支的修改。
2. 根据需要,手动编辑文件,选择要保留的修改或进行修改。确保最终的文件是正确的。
3. 保存文件后,使用以下命令将解决冲突后的文件标记为已解决:
“`
git add
“`
4. 提交解决冲突的更改:
“`
git commit -m “解决冲突”
“`
这将提交你的解决冲突的更改,并继续合并过程。以上是关于git.dev分支的一些操作流程和解决冲突的方法。希望可以帮助你更好地理解和使用git.dev分支。请记住,在使用分支时务必小心,并确保及时合并和删除不再需要的分支,以保持版本控制的整洁和准确性。
1年前